Overview



The x360 Chromebook built for teaching and learning
Empower students to realize their potential with personalized, interactive, cloud-first[1]<'sup> learning on the HP Chromebook x360 11 G3 EE. The flexible, durable HP chassis supports every way students learn; the fast-booting Chrome OS is immediately ready and makes management easy.




At-a-glance



  • 29.5 cm (11.6") diagonal HD touch display

  • 4 GB memory; 32 GB eMMC storage

  • Chrome OS™

  • Enable students to learn in their own way with 360°-adjustability into four modes and access to over 200 Android™ and G Suite education apps.[1]

  • Give students a Chromebook that can survive a fall off a desk[5], a splash from a soda[6] or a tugged power cord. It resists spills[6] and attempts to remove keys, has metal-reinforced corners, and is 122 cm[5] drop tested—higher than most desks.

  • Intel® Celeron® N4020 with Intel® UHD Graphics 600 (1.1 GHz base frequency, up to 2.8 GHz burst frequency, 4 MB cache, 2 cores)

  • Intel® UHD Graphics 600

  • Quickly stream and access textbooks, tests, and more with Intel® processors[7] and the Chrome OS. Work continuously with a long battery life and fast recharging. Make it easy to control and manage student interactions with HP Classroom Manager.[8]
